To start, the amp rating of a vape battery is a measure of the maximum current the battery can discharge safely. This rating is critical because drawing too much current from a battery can cause it to overheat, which may result in battery failure and even explosions in extreme cases. Therefore, understanding how to calculate and interpret this rating is essential for any vaper, especially for those who use sub-ohm devices that require higher wattages.
One of the primary ways to know a vape battery’s amp rating is by checking the manufacturer’s specifications. Most reputable battery manufacturers will provide detailed information on their products, including amp ratings. For example, a common label might indicate a continuous discharge rating of 20A or 30A. This is the maximum amount of current the battery can supply without risking failure. Always refer to the manufacturer’s datasheet or website for the most accurate details.
If the manufacturer’s specifications are not available, you can use a simple formula to estimate the safe amp draw for your setup. The formula is:
Wattage = Voltage x Amps
In this formula, wattage refers to the power output of your vape device, voltage is the voltage of the battery (usually 3.7V for lithium-ion batteries), and amps is the current draw. For instance, if your device operates at 80 watts, you can rearrange the formula to find the necessary amps: Amps = Wattage / Voltage. In this case, 80W / 3.7V = approximately 21.6A. This means you should use a battery with a continuous discharge rating of at least 22A to ensure safe operation.
Lastly, be mindful of the importance of using high-quality batteries from trusted brands. Counterfeit or low-quality batteries may not have accurate amp ratings, posing serious risks. Always prioritize safety by purchasing from reputable sources and verifying the authenticity of the battery.
